The Bluffton Bobcats just played last yesterday, but they'll still welcome the Christ Church Episcopal Cavaliers at 5:30 p.m. on Saturday. Both come into the matchup b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
Bluffton is looking to give their home crowd another W after opening their season at home on Friday. They had just enough and edged out John Paul II 54-51.
Meanwhile, Christ Church Episcopal put another one in the bag on Thursday to keep their perfect season alive. They really took it to Clear Dot Charter for the full four quarters, racking up a 70-42 win. The Cavaliers pushed the score to 53-29 by the end of the third, a deficit the Bats had little chance of recovering from.
Bluffton better keep an eye on Jude Hall. He was instrumental in Christ Church Episcopal's win, almost dropping a double-double with 18 points and nine boards. Another player making a difference was Jonathan Perry, who went 7-for-10 en route to 19 points.
